SUMMARY & BACKGROUND (First sentence includes Agency recommendation. Provide an executive summary of the action that gives an overview of the relevant details for the item.)

Scope of Work: The Department of Arts & Cultural recommends the approval of a contract with the Bear Creek Nature Center, Inc. a Georgia non-profit organization that provides environmental educational services on a scheduled basis for the benefit Fulton County citizens and visitors. Scheduled environmental educational services will be conducted targeting service delivery in South Fulton County through programs that are designed to promote awareness and appreciation of the environment. The Bear Creek Nature Center's staff will develop environmental education programs that connect to science, technology, engineering, arts and mathematics.
